What is recorded here

Affixed to the S wall, and to the W of the original doorway of The White Castle (KD035-022010-). A rectangular stone (H 0.50m; Wth 0.90m) bearing the arms of the Fitzgeralds, carved in relief. Its original location is unknown. There is a memorial stone (KD035-022023-) on the other side of the doorway. (Bradley et al. 1986a, vol. 1, 47-8) Compiled by: Gearóid Conroy Date of upload: 11 December 2013
